🥗 Cobb Salad with Homemade Ranch Dressing
🛒 Ingredients
For the Salad:
-
6 cups chopped Romaine lettuce
-
2 hard-boiled eggs, peeled and quartered
-
1 cup cooked and crumbled bacon
-
1 cup grilled or roasted chicken breast, diced
-
1 avocado, sliced or diced
-
1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
-
1/2 cup blue cheese or feta, crumbled
-
1/2 cup thinly sliced red onion (optional)
-
1/2 cup cucumber, sliced (optional)
For the Homemade Ranch Dressing:
-
1/2 cup mayonnaise
-
1/2 cup sour cream (or Greek yogurt)
-
1/4 to 1/3 cup buttermilk (adjust for desired thickness)
-
1 tablespoon lemon juice or white vinegar
-
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
-
1/2 teaspoon onion powder
-
1/2 teaspoon dried dill
-
1/2 teaspoon dried parsley
-
1/4 teaspoon salt
-
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
-
Optional: 1 tablespoon fresh chives, finely chopped
🥣 Instructions
1. Make the Ranch Dressing:
-
In a medium bowl, whisk together mayo, sour cream, and buttermilk until smooth.
-
Add lemon juice, garlic powder, onion powder, dill, parsley, salt, pepper, and chives (if using).
-
Taste and adjust seasoning. Chill for at least 15 minutes for flavors to meld.
2. Assemble the Salad:
-
Spread the chopped romaine lettuce over a large platter or bowl.
-
Arrange the toppings in rows or sections: eggs, bacon, chicken, avocado, tomatoes, cheese, onion, and cucumber if using.
-
Drizzle with ranch dressing just before serving, or serve on the side.
🔄 Tips & Variations
-
Swap grilled chicken with turkey or steak for variety.
-
For extra crunch, add croutons or sunflower seeds.
-
To make it lighter, use Greek yogurt in place of sour cream and reduce mayo.
